Product and Industry Overview
The spirit level, a fundamental instrument in the arsenal of precision measuring tools, is an indispensable device for determining if a surface is perfectly horizontal (level) or vertical (plumb). Its core technology, a sealed vial containing a liquid and a captive air bubble, has remained conceptually unchanged for centuries, yet the modern spirit level industry is characterized by significant innovation in materials, accuracy, and functionality. These tools are no longer simple implements but are highly engineered products designed for specific applications, ranging from heavy-duty I-beam and box-beam levels for construction to compact torpedo levels for plumbing and electrical work.
The most significant technological evolution in the market has been the advent of digital spirit levels. These advanced tools integrate electronic sensors and LCD screens to provide a precise digital readout of angles, inclines, and percentages. Features such as audible alerts for level/plumb, memory functions, and backlight displays have transformed the tool's utility, offering speed and precision far beyond the capabilities of a traditional bubble vial. This shift towards digitalization is a key factor reshaping the competitive landscape and user expectations.
The global demand for these essential tools is intrinsically linked to the health of the construction, renovation, and manufacturing sectors. In 2026, the global spirit levels market is estimated to reach a valuation between 0.7 billion USD and 1.3 billion USD. Driven by sustained global infrastructure development, a robust residential renovation market, and the increasing sophistication of DIY enthusiasts, the market is projected to expand at a steady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 4.8% to 6.5% during the forecast period from 2026 to 2031.
Regional Market Dynamics
The global spirit levels market exhibits distinct regional characteristics, shaped by local construction practices, manufacturing strengths, and consumer behavior.
• North America: North America represents a mature and substantial market for spirit levels. The region's demand is characterized by a strong professional trade base and a highly developed Do-It-Yourself (DIY) culture, fueled by large home improvement retail chains. The residential construction and renovation sectors are major consumers, with a high preference for durable, feature-rich tools from established brands. The adoption of digital levels is particularly high among professional contractors seeking efficiency gains.
• Europe: Europe is a hub of high-precision manufacturing and craftsmanship, a legacy reflected in its spirit level market. German manufacturers, in particular, are globally renowned for their exceptionally accurate and durable products. The market is driven by stringent building codes and a professional user base that prioritizes longevity and guaranteed accuracy over price. The renovation of historical buildings and a strong woodworking tradition also contribute to the demand for high-quality leveling tools.
• Asia-Pacific: The Asia-Pacific region is the fastest-growing market for spirit levels. This growth is propelled by massive urbanization, large-scale infrastructure projects in China, India, and Southeast Asian nations, and a burgeoning manufacturing sector. The region is also home to major global tool manufacturers who serve both domestic and international markets. While there is a strong demand for cost-effective tools for general construction, there is a rapidly growing segment of professionals adopting higher-end, international-standard tools.
• South America and MEA: These emerging markets show steady growth tied to their construction and resource-based industries. Demand is often driven by large commercial and infrastructure projects. While price sensitivity can be a factor, the increasing presence of global contractors in these regions is elevating the standard and demand for professional-grade, reliable measuring tools.
Application Segments and Growth Trends
The spirit level market is segmented by its primary end-user applications, each with specific requirements for durability, accuracy, and features.
• Construction and Renovation: This is the largest and most demanding application segment. Professionals in framing, masonry, drywall installation, and general contracting rely on spirit levels for foundational tasks. The trend in this segment is towards highly durable, impact-resistant levels, often with features like strong rare-earth magnets for hands-free work on steel studs or beams. Box-beam levels are preferred for their rigidity and strength, while digital levels are gaining popularity for complex tasks like setting gradients for drainage.
• Metal and Wood Processing: This segment includes cabinet makers, furniture builders, metal fabricators, and machinists who require the highest degree of precision. In these workshop environments, spirit levels are used for machinery setup, ensuring workbenches are perfectly flat, and for detailed fabrication work. Specialized products like high-precision machinist's levels, which have extremely sensitive vials, are essential in this application.
• DIY (Do-It-Yourself): The DIY segment is a high-volume market driven by homeowners undertaking their own renovation and decoration projects. For these users, tasks range from hanging pictures and installing shelves to more complex projects like tiling or building decks. The trend in this segment is towards affordability, user-friendliness, and multi-functionality. Tool manufacturers often bundle spirit levels in home tool kits and design products with features that are appealing to non-professionals.
Value Chain and Supply Chain Structure
The value chain for the spirit level market involves precision manufacturing, strategic branding, and a multi-channel distribution network.
• Upstream: The value chain begins with the procurement of raw materials. The primary material for the body of high-quality levels is aluminum, chosen for its strength-to-weight ratio. The upstream process also involves the manufacturing of the critical vial component, typically from high-impact acrylic, and the formulation of the specialized, non-freezing liquid inside. The precision milling of the aluminum frame and the calibration of the vials are the most critical, value-adding steps at this stage.
• Midstream: This stage involves the assembly, branding, and packaging by the tool manufacturers. Companies like STANLEY, Stabila, and Milwaukee invest heavily in R&D to improve vial accuracy, frame ergonomics, and digital sensor technology. The brand's reputation, built on years of reliability and guaranteed accuracy, is a key intangible asset created in the midstream.
• Downstream: The downstream comprises the distribution and retail channels that deliver the product to the end-user. This is a complex network that includes specialized industrial supply distributors for professional contractors, large big-box home improvement retailers for the DIY market, and a growing number of online e-commerce platforms. The consolidation of distributors is a major trend shaping the downstream landscape.
Competitive Landscape and Strategic Activity
The spirit levels market is highly competitive, featuring a mix of globally recognized brands, specialized high-precision manufacturers, and large-scale producers from Asia. Key market players include East Precision Measuring Tools, STANLEY, Stabila, Milwaukee, Bosch, Ningbo Great Wall, HULTAFORS Group, Kapro Industries, SOLA-Messwerkzeuge, and GreatStar, among many others.
• Global Diversified Brands: Players like STANLEY (part of Stanley Black & Decker) and Bosch leverage their massive brand recognition and extensive distribution networks to serve both professional and DIY segments with a wide range of products.
• Professional Power Tool Brands: Companies like Milwaukee have successfully expanded from their core power tool business into hand tools, including spirit levels. They capitalize on strong brand loyalty among professional tradespeople, often offering leveling tools as part of a larger, integrated system of products.
• Specialized Premium Manufacturers: Brands like Stabila (Germany) have built their entire reputation on producing arguably the most accurate and durable levels in the world. They command a premium price and are the tool of choice for professionals who demand the absolute best.
• Large-Scale Asian Manufacturers: Companies like GreatStar are major forces in the global tool industry, acting as both OEM partners for many Western brands and increasingly building their own global brand portfolios.
The broader professional tool and supply industry is currently undergoing a phase of active consolidation, which directly impacts how spirit levels are sold and distributed:
• Consolidation in Distribution: On October 23, 2024, NEFCO, a specialty supply partner for construction trades, announced the acquisition of Sheinberg Tool Co. This move, one of nine acquisitions by NEFCO since 2022, highlights a key downstream trend: the creation of large, regional super-distributors. This consolidation aims to provide a one-stop-shop solution for contractors, simplifying their procurement and strengthening the market position of the distributor and the brands they carry.
• Consolidation in Manufacturing: On November 8, 2024, Malco Tools, Inc., a manufacturer of tools for HVAC and construction, was acquired by Aspen Pumps Group. This type of acquisition shows a trend of larger industrial groups acquiring specialized tool manufacturers to broaden their product portfolios and gain access to new professional trade segments.
• Consolidation in Niche/Safety Tools: On April 3, 2025, Billy Pugh Company acquired Stiffy Safe Hand Tools. While focused on the offshore industry, this acquisition is indicative of a broader trend in the hand tool market where companies are consolidating product lines to offer more comprehensive safety and specialty solutions to specific industrial end-users.
Market Opportunities
• Digitalization and Connectivity: The largest opportunity lies in the continued development of digital levels. Future innovations may include Bluetooth connectivity to sync with project management apps, allowing for data logging and quality control documentation directly from the tool.
• Material Science and Ergonomics: There is an opportunity to use lighter-weight materials like magnesium or advanced composites to create levels that are less fatiguing for users during a long workday, without compromising on strength or accuracy.
• Niche Product Development: Designing levels for specific trades (e.g., levels with built-in pitch vials for plumbers, or specialized levels for scaffolders and electricians) can create high-margin revenue streams and build strong loyalty within specific professional communities.
• Growth in Emerging Markets: As construction standards and worker skill levels rise in developing economies, there will be a significant shift from basic, low-cost tools to more reliable and accurate professional-grade spirit levels.
Market Challenges
• Technological Displacement by Laser Levels: Laser levels represent the most significant competitive threat to traditional and even digital spirit levels. For tasks requiring leveling over long distances or establishing a consistent height reference across an entire room, lasers are often faster and more efficient. Spirit level manufacturers must innovate to emphasize their tool's durability, portability, and simplicity for tasks where lasers are impractical.
• Commoditization and Price Pressure: In the basic and DIY segments of the market, there is intense price competition from low-cost, unbranded imports. This commoditization puts pressure on the profit margins of established brands and makes it difficult to compete on price alone.
• Maintaining Manufacturing Accuracy: A spirit level's sole purpose is to be accurate. The manufacturing process, from milling the frame to setting the vial, requires extremely tight tolerances. Any lapse in quality control can lead to inaccurate tools, which can severely damage a brand's reputation.
• Fluctuations in Raw Material Costs: The market is sensitive to the price of aluminum, which is the primary raw material for most level bodies. Volatility in global commodity markets can directly impact production costs and consumer pricing.
